What Are the Key Ingredients for a Perfect Steak Sandwich?
The best steak sandwich starts with good meat. I recommend flank steak. It has great flavor and tender texture. When cooked right, it melts in your mouth. Slice it thin against the grain. This makes each bite easier to chew.
Next, let’s talk about bread. I love using ciabatta rolls. They are crusty on the outside and soft inside. This texture holds up well to juicy steak. You can also use hoagie rolls or sourdough. Just make sure it can hold the fillings without falling apart.
Fresh ingredients are vital too. Choose bright, crisp arugula for a peppery kick. Ripe tomatoes add sweetness and juiciness. Thinly sliced red onions give a nice crunch and bite. Always pick the freshest produce you can find. It makes your sandwich taste better.
For a dip, homemade garlic aioli is key. It brings a rich, creamy flavor. You can whip it up with just mayonnaise, garlic,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. This sauce will elevate your sandwich to new heights.

How Do You Prepare Garlic Aioli for Your Steak Sandwich?
To make a great garlic aioli, start with simple ingredients. The basic recipe includes mayonnaise, fresh garlic,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. These ingredients blend together to create a creamy and rich sauce.
What Are the Essential Ingredients for Garlic Aioli?
The main ingredients are 1/2 cup of mayonnaise and 2 cloves of minced garlic. Mayonnaise provides a smooth base, while garlic adds a strong flavor. You also need 1 tablespoon of lemon juice for brightness. Finally, add salt and pepper to taste. These ingredients work together to create a tasty garlic aioli.
How Can You Achieve the Perfect Consistency for Your Aioli?
Achieving the right consistency is easy. Start by whisking the mayonnaise and minced garlic together in a bowl. Add the lemon juice slowly and mix well. The aioli should be thick but spreadable. If it seems too thick, add a little water or more lemon juice. This helps the aioli spread nicely on your sandwich.
What Are the Flavor Variations for Garlic Aioli?
You can change the flavor of aioli in many ways. For a spicy kick, add a dash of hot sauce or some cayenne pepper. If you want a fresh taste, mix in some chopped herbs like parsley or basil. For a smoky flavor, try adding smoked paprika. Each twist makes your garlic aioli unique and tasty, perfect for your steak sandwich.

What Cooking Techniques Are Best for Grilling a Steak Sandwich?
When it comes to cooking steak for sandwiches, I recommend a few key techniques. First, you can grill or pan-sear your steak. Both methods work well, but grilling adds a nice smoky flavor. You want to use high heat for a quick cook. This keeps the steak juicy and tender.
Do You Need to Marinate the Steak?
No, you do not need to marinate the steak. Flank steak has a strong flavor on its own. A simple seasoning of salt and pepper is often enough. If you want extra taste, you can add garlic or herbs. Just keep it simple so the meat shines.
What Are the Best Cooking Methods for Flank Steak?
For flank steak, I prefer to pan-sear it in a skillet or grill it. Both methods give you a nice crust while keeping it juicy inside. If you grill, make sure the grill is very hot. Cook for about 2-3 minutes on each side for a medium-rare finish. You want that beautiful brown color.
How Can You Ensure Your Steak is Cooked to Perfection?
To check if your steak is cooked to perfection, use a meat thermometer. Aim for 130°F for medium-rare. If you don’t have a thermometer, use the touch test. Press the meat with your finger; it should feel firm but still spring back. Remember, let the steak rest for a few minutes before slicing. How Can You Elevate Your Sandwich with Toppings?
Toppings can make or break your sandwich. A classic choice is sautéed peppers. They add a sweet crunch. You can also use mushrooms for a rich and earthy taste. Try adding cheese, too. Melted provolone or sharp cheddar works great. A handful of fresh herbs can brighten everything up.
What Unique Ingredients Can You Add for Flavor?
For a twist, think beyond the usual. Pickled onions add a tangy crunch. Avocado slices give a creamy texture. You can also use spicy sauces like chipotle mayo. This adds heat and depth. If you enjoy a bit of sweetness, caramelized onions are perfect. They balance the savory steak nicely.
Which Combinations Make the Best Flavor Profiles?
Some flavor combos stand out. Steak with blue cheese and arugula is a classic. The strong cheese pairs well with the beef. Another great mix is steak with roasted red peppers and goat cheese. The creaminess of the cheese complements the peppers.

How Do You Assemble a Gourmet Steak Sandwich?
What Are the Steps to Properly Assemble Your Sandwich?
To make a gourmet steak sandwich, start with toasted bread. I prefer ciabatta rolls for their crusty edges and soft center. After toasting, spread garlic aioli on both halves. This adds a creamy flavor that pairs well with steak. Next, layer the fresh arugula on the bottom half. The arugula adds a peppery taste and looks vibrant. Then, add the thinly sliced flank steak. Make sure each piece is juicy and tender. On top of the steak, arrange tomato slices and red onion. This adds color and crunch. Finally, place the top half of the roll on the fillings. Press down gently to hold it all together.
